Painting Description
"Le Père Melon Fendant du Bois" is a notable painting by the renowned French artist Camille Pissarro, created in 1867. Pissarro, a pivotal figure in the Impressionist movement, is celebrated for his depictions of rural life and landscapes, and this work is a testament to his keen observation and empathetic portrayal of the working class.
The painting captures an elderly man, referred to as "Père Melon," engaged in the laborious task of splitting wood. The scene is set in a rustic, rural environment, which is characteristic of Pissarro's oeuvre. The artist's attention to detail is evident in the meticulous rendering of the textures of the wood, the man's worn clothing, and the surrounding natural elements. The composition is both intimate and expansive, drawing the viewer into the daily life of the subject while also situating him within the broader landscape.
Pissarro's use of color and light in "Le Père Melon Fendant du Bois" exemplifies his mastery of the Impressionist technique. The interplay of light and shadow on the man's figure and the wood he is splitting creates a dynamic sense of movement and realism. The earthy tones and subtle variations in color reflect the natural environment and the time of day, enhancing the painting's authenticity and emotional resonance.
This work is significant not only for its artistic qualities but also for its social commentary. By choosing to depict a humble laborer with dignity and respect, Pissarro challenges the traditional hierarchy of subjects in art. He elevates the everyday activities of ordinary people to the level of fine art, aligning with the democratic ideals of the Impressionist movement.
"Le Père Melon Fendant du Bois" is housed in the collection of the Musée d'Orsay in Paris, where it continues to be admired for its technical excellence and its poignant portrayal of rural life. The painting remains an important example of Pissarro's commitment to capturing the essence of the human experience through his art.
